Kia India is all set to strengthen its electric portfolio in the Indian market. The company will soon launch its new electric car Kia Ciros, and some important details have surfaced online even before its launch. The car will be Kia’s smallest electric in India, slotting in the segment below the Kia Carens Clavis. Once launched, it will compete directly with the likes of Tata Nexon, Maruti E-Vitara, Toyota Ebella and Mahindra.

Battery pack and powerful range According to leaked online information, the Kia Syros will be available with two battery pack options,

42 kWh battery pack

Along with this, the car is claimed to offer a range of around 443 km. 51.4 kWh Battery Pack: With this large battery pack, the car can run as much as 520 kilometers on a single charge. Interestingly, the Hyundai Creta and Kia Carens Clavis also use the same size battery pack. However, since the Ciros is smaller in size and lighter in weight, it is expected to offer more driving range than the Creta despite having the same battery capacity.

LIFETIME BATTERY WARRANTY!

The biggest feature of this car is going to be its ownership package. According to sources, the company may offer a 15-year or outright lifetime battery warranty on the car, which will be the best coverage plan for any car available in India. Apart from this, the car will get a standard warranty of 3 years, which can be extended up to 7 years or 1.6 lakh kilometers.

Exterior, Interior and Features The Kia Ciros will look similar to its petrol/diesel version. This car will come with a boxy shape and good height. The front fender on the passenger side will feature a charging flap and will feature a unique design bumper and alloy wheels. Coming to the interior, its dashboard will be similar to the petrol version, but it may get a -specific display, new trim and upholstery. It is also likely to have vehicle-to-load and vehicle-to-vehicle charging capabilities.

Probable Price The ex-showroom price of this new Kia Citroën in the Indian market is highly likely to be between Rs.15 lakh and Rs.20 lakh.
